WebHow to delete files with the del command. Now that Command Prompt is open, use cd to change directories to where your files are. I’ve prepared a directory on the desktop called Test Folder. You can use the command tree /f to see a, well, tree, of all the nested files and folders: For example, to delete Test file.txt, just run del "Test File.txt". WebJan 25, 2024 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 7 Use os.listdir () to get the contents of the directory, os.path.isdir (path) to see if it is a folder, and if it is, shutil.rmtree (path) to delete the folder and all its content.
